> Hello folks,
>       Hope everyone had a wonderful holiday and good rest in passed weeks. We 
> just had a 2.6.3 release on Dec.17 and now it is a good time to look forward 
> to the next branch-2.6 maintenance release - 2.6.4 in the beginning of new 
> year. As usual, this release will be based on latest release 2.6.3 but 
> include a couple of critical/blocker bug fixes that identified in community 
> recently.
>
> Things Done/TODO:
>
>  + Schedule
>    -- According to previous email discussion thread in community, we are 
> prefering fast-moving way (roughly as monthly) of releasing fixes on 
> branch-2.6. So I would expect this release could happen around end of Jan. or 
> early of Feb. dependens on if RC & VOTE process going on smoothly. Also, it 
> should be after release 2.7.2 to get rid of any possible disturb to that 
> release.
>
>  + Branch
>    -- 2.6.4 will be based on branch-2.6, which has been open to 2.6.4 commits 
> for a while. I plan to branch out branch-2.6.4 sometime next week according 
> to status of target/fixed fixes.
>    -- Before 2.6.4 branch is cut off, new commits coming as fix to 2.6.4 is 
> good to commit/merge to trunk, branch-2 and branch-2.6.
>
>  + Patches
>    -- In last couple of days, I went through all critial/blocker bug fixes in 
> the coming 2.7.2 release and ping authors/committers on JIRA to ask for the 
> same effort on branch-2.6.4. I could do more rounds of the same practice in 
> case I could miss something helpful. Also, a kindly reminder from original 
> author and committer is also appreciated.
>    -- So far, 2.6.4 already has 18 fixes as list of [1] shows. However, there 
> are totally 55 fixes target for 2.6.4 for now [2], so there is still a large 
> gap and we need to work harder to resolve these tickets as many as we can and 
> push out some non-critical ones to meet our promise of date.
>
>  + Release
>    -- Still too early to do anything directly related to RC. Will work on 
> resolve fixes in list of [2] first, and appreciate any help on this effort.
